Welcome
to the New York office of the Konrad Adenauer Stiftung! As a foundation close to Germany’s “CDU” (Christian Democrat Party) we advocate internationally for peace, freedom and justice. The New York office focuses on the United Nations, building up synergies between the foundation´s partners all over the world and the UN.
